Production: Grapes from vineyards at 900 meters of altitude. Located on the southern side of Gran Canaria, with a predominance of dry periods and large temperature differentials. Fermented in stainless steel tanks.
Variety of grapes: Malvasía Volcánica, Verdello, Albillo Criollo.

Tasting note: Straw yellow, clear, clean. Nose elegant and suggestive. Notes of ripe fruit and elements of citrus. Attack vibrant in the mouth, with an acidity that supports the skeleton of the wine and allows to extend the fruity sensations. Length envelope, greasy and lightweight counterpoint of bitterness that reminds of their varietals.
Food pairing: All kinds of cheeses, rice dishes, fish, seafood, white meats, and to highlight the great harmony with the asian food.
Service temperature: 12ºC.
